Measurements:
- White Card Base 4 1/4″ x 11″ scored at 5 1/2″
- Strip of Calypso Coral Card Stock 1 7/8″ x 5 1/2″
- Strip of Happiness Blooms DSP 1 3/4″ x 5 1/2″
- Calypso Coral Card Stock Layer 3 7/8″ x 5 1/8″
- White Die Cut Card Stock 3 3/8″ x 4 3/4″
Details:
- This very bright and bold pattern is from the Happiness Blooms DSP pack. Isn’t it amazing?!? I used to be intimidated by this type of pattern, but I am learning how to work with it. Once it’s paired up with elements whose colors are drawn directly from the DSP, the pattern tones down. It’s kind of magical!
- There is a stamp set called Bloom by Bloom in the Occasions Catalog that exactly matches this DSP, but I don’t have it (yet). So…I improvised! The set I used is called Bunch of Blossoms from the Annual Catalog.
- The catalog doesn’t list a pink color for this paper pack, but after stamping with a few different pinks I determined that the pink is Blushing Bride.
- The blooms are Blushing Bride and Calypso Coral and those two colors combined with Call Me Clover is, well, magical!!
- I paired the Bunch of Blossoms stamp set with a sentiment from Petal Palette and then die cut it and layered it onto a Calypso Coral oval scallop die cut.
- This darling Calypso Coral 3/8″ Satin Ribbon is from the same suite of products. I love the satin finish as well as the width – perfect for a simple knot!
- Lastly, the Happiness Blooms Enamel Dots in Call Me Clover are the sweetest accents…make sure you get some, they are soon cute in three sizes!

Supplies (all Stampin’ Up! unless otherwise noted):
Card Stock: Calypso Coral and Neenah Classic Crest Cover Solar White (80 lb)
DSP: Happiness Blossoms
Ink: Blushing Bride, Call Me Clover and Calypso Coral, Tuxedo Black Memento, Versamark
Stamps: Bunch of Blossoms and Petal Palette
Dies: Layering Ovals Framelits Dies, Stitched Shapes Framelits Dies, Rectangle Stitched Framelits Dies
Tools: Big Shot
Embellishments: Calypso Coral 3/8″ Satin Ribbon, Happiness Blooms Enamel Dots; Wink of Stella
Other: Whisper White Envelope
